Hi, I have a query. A female worker is working in a factory where ESI is NOT applicable. Her salary is 25000, which exceeds the legal wage ceiling (Rs 21000) for benefits under the ESI Act. In such a scenario, is she eligible for cash benefits by the employer for all the leave taken before and after delivery?

Yes, she is eligible provided she had worked for 80 days before the commencement of her leave.

If the company's all-inclusive manpower is 10 or more, the Maternity Benefit Act is applicable to it. There is no mention of salary in the act; it is applicable to all female employees. Benefits under ESI and the maternity act are the same.
